U-1278Type VIIC/41
Feldpost NumberM 30 549
Construction YardVulkan Vegesack Werft, Bremen
Yard Number73
Ordered13th Jun 1942
Keel laid12th Aug 1943
Launched15th Apr 1944
Commissioned31st May 1944
Baubelehrung6.KLA, Bremen
Training, Flotillas and Duties
05.44 - 11.448.U-Flottille, Danzig
Ausbildungsboot (under training)
12.44 - 02.4511.U-Flottille, Bergen
Frontboot (operational)
Commanders
05.44 - 02.45OL ~ KL Erich Müller-Bethke

Operations information for U-1278
31.01.1945 - 02.02.1945
First Sailing
U-1278 left Kiel under the command of Erich Müller-Bethke on 31st Jan 1945 and arrived at Horten on 2nd Feb 1945 after two days.
11.02.1945 - 17.02.1945
Second Sailing - active patrol
On the 11th Feb 1945, U-1278 left Horten under the command of Erich Müller-Bethke. The boat was lost on 17th Feb 1945.
